Understanding Post-Mold Remediation Process





After completing the mold remediation process, it is essential to comprehend the post-mold remediation methods that are essential to make certain a comprehensive and effective cleanup. When the mold has been gotten rid of, the following action includes cleaning and disinfecting the affected locations to avoid any kind of regrowth of mold and mildew. This includes using specialized cleansing agents to wipe down surface areas and eliminate any remaining mold and mildew spores. Correct air flow and dehumidification can aid in this procedure.


Moreover, conducting a last inspection post-remediation is important to ensure that all mold has actually been successfully removed. This inspection must involve a comprehensive aesthetic check in addition to perhaps air tasting to validate the lack of mold spores airborne. Extra removal might be needed if the inspection exposes any type of sticking around mold. Finally, enlightening occupants on safety nets such as controlling moisture levels and immediately addressing any type of water leaks can aid maintain a mold-free setting.

Applying complete cleaning and disinfecting approaches is crucial in making certain the total elimination of mold spores post-remediation. After removing visible mold growth, it is vital to cleanse all surfaces in the affected location to eliminate any kind of staying mold and mildew spores. One efficient approach is utilizing a mixture of water and cleaning agent to scrub surface areas intensely. This helps in literally removing the mold and mildew and its spores from the surfaces. After cleansing, decontaminating the location is critical to kill any kind of continuing to be mold and mildew spores and stop regrowth. An option of water and bleach or an industrial disinfectant specifically made for mold removal can be related to the cleaned up surface areas. It is necessary to allow the disinfectant sit for the recommended dwell time to ensure its performance. Additionally, using HEPA vacuum cleaners and air scrubbers can additionally aid in eliminating air-borne mold and mildew particles, offering a much more comprehensive cleaning procedure. By adhering to these meticulous cleaning and decontaminating approaches, you can successfully clear the room of mold and mildew contamination and advertise a much healthier interior environment.

Monitoring and Upkeep Tips





Provided the vital role that correct ventilation plays in stopping mold growth, it is vital to establish remove mold borax reliable tracking and maintenance ideas to make sure the continued functionality of air flow systems. Regular examinations of ventilation systems should be performed to look for any indicators of obstructions, leakages, or malfunctions that could restrain appropriate airflow. Surveillance humidity levels within the home is additionally important, as high moisture can add to mold and mildew growth. Setting up a hygrometer can aid track humidity degrees and alert house owners to any kind of spikes that may need focus. Furthermore, making certain that air filters are frequently cleansed or replaced is vital for keeping the efficiency of the ventilation system. Applying a schedule for regular upkeep jobs, such as duct cleaning and heating and cooling system examinations, can aid prevent problems prior to they escalate. By staying positive and alert to the condition of ventilation systems, building proprietors can effectively reduce the danger of mold and mildew regrowth and keep a healthy and balanced interior setting.
